Default [Resolved] No wireless to laptop............

Hi all........... Again!!!

My sis (yeah the same one grrrrr). has got a d-link router connected to her pc.. Which is working all fine on getting her onto the internet.
The problem is.... Her daughters (my niece) laptop won't connect to it.

Any ideas on how i can resolve this???

Router is...... D-link DKT-710
Laptop is..... Gateway ML3108B

Heres hoping..... again!!!

Lynn

Default Re: No wireless to laptop............

Lynn - I don't know the DLink router in question but google advises it is wireless capable.

So first things first - is the wireless configured and enabled? Usually you connect via a web browser to the router - dlink typically use 192.168.1.1 as a default so you'd http://192.168.1.a from the main PC. Then login (user id and p/wd are default to 'admin' 'admin') and find the wireless setup tab. It doesn't look like the router has a staus light for the wireless unfortunately so that won't help in knowing if it is on or off.

Once configured and enabled at the router end, you need to match that config on the PC / laptop end. Again google tells me that laptop has built-in wireless but I can't see if there is a button (as per my laptop) to turn on/off the wireless hardware.

Have a potch around and see what you can find out and come back. Then we can discuss how to's of configuring - as in use WPA and never touch WEP if you can.

Default Re: No wireless to laptop............

The laptop is 802.11g compliant which is one of the modes supported by the router.

OK - non techy as best I can.

Open up a command window - START - RUN - type in CMD , click OK.
In the black box that opens up type IPCONFIG.

Note down the numbers that are the IP and Default Gateway. Likely to start 192.168.x.y

Now open up a browser session and in the address bar type in the numbers that were the default gateway and press enter.

You will likely come to a login page - I can't help anymore with this one

Find the setup page/s and specifically look for the wireless setup and report the details back - or get your sister to do a screen dump. If needs be attach that screen dump to this thread.

Then we can talk some more ...
